How far in advance should I book my wedding flowers?
It’s best to book your wedding flowers as early as possible, ideally 6-12 months before your wedding. This ensures availability and gives us ample time to source the freshest seasonal flowers that match your vision. If your wedding date is sooner, don’t worry—we’ll do our best to accommodate last-minute requests!

Can you work within my budget?
Absolutely! We believe beautiful flowers should be accessible to everyone, regardless of budget. Let us know your price range, and we’ll suggest options that provide the best value while staying true to your style. We’ll guide you through the most impactful floral choices that suit your budget. Our full service minimum is $3500-$5000 depending on location. We are happy to offer pick up at any budget.

How much do wedding flowers typically cost?
Costs vary depending on the size of your wedding, the types of flowers chosen, and the complexity of the arrangements. We’ll provide a detailed quote after our initial consultation, and we’re happy to make adjustments to fit your budget. Our average couple usually makes a $5,000-$10,000 floral commitment.
